CVE-2026-22564
Received Received - Intake
Improper Access Control in UniFi Play Enables Unauthorized SSH

Publication date: 2026-04-13

Last updated on: 2026-04-13

Assigner: HackerOne

Description
An Improper Access Control vulnerability could allow a malicious actor with access to the UniFi Play network to enable SSH to make unauthorized changes to the system.
 Affected Products: UniFi Play PowerAmp (Version 1.0.35 and earlier)
 UniFi Play Audio Port  (Version 1.0.24 and earlier)
 Mitigation: Update UniFi Play PowerAmp to Version 1.0.38 or later
 Update UniFi Play Audio Port  to Version 1.1.9 or later

Executive Summary

This vulnerability is an Improper Access Control issue in certain UniFi Play devices. It allows a malicious actor who already has access to the UniFi Play network to enable SSH access on the device. By enabling SSH, the attacker can make unauthorized changes to the system.

Impact Analysis

The impact of this vulnerability is severe because it allows an attacker to gain unauthorized control over affected devices. With SSH enabled, the attacker can make unauthorized system changes, potentially compromising the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the device and any data it handles.

Mitigation Strategies

To mitigate this vulnerability, update your affected UniFi devices to the fixed versions.

  • Update UniFi Play PowerAmp to Version 1.0.38 or later.
  • Update UniFi Play Audio Port to Version 1.1.9 or later.
